The Role

We are looking for a knowledgeable and proactive Fabric Technologist to join our product development and sourcing team. This role is critical to ensuring the technical performance, compliance, and commercial viability of fabrics used across our collections. You will be responsible for fabric testing, care label approvals, volume reviews, and supporting the sourcing process - including negotiating minimum order quantities (MOQs) and pricing with mills.

Roles and Responsibilities
  1. Fabric Testing & Compliance
    • Oversee and interpret fabric test results in line with internal and external standards (e.g., ISO, REACH, OEKO-TEX).
    • Ensure all fabrics meet performance and safety requirements for target markets.
    • Liaise with suppliers/test laboratories to ensure accurate and timely testing.
    • Keep up to date with fabric compliance regulations globally and communicate relevant updates internally.
  2. Care Label Approval
    • Evaluate test data to determine correct care labelling requirements for each fabric.
    • Approve final care instructions in line with legal and brand guidelines.
    • Work cross-functionally with design, QA, and compliance teams to ensure care label information is accurate and consistent.
  3. Fabric Sourcing Support
    • Support fabric selection and sourcing with the design and product development teams.
    • Provide technical guidance during the development process, assessing suitability for end use, performance, and sustainability.
    • Maintain an up-to-date fabric library and database, including certifications, compositions, and lead times.
  4. Volume Review & Supplier Liaison
    • Review seasonal fabric requirements, consolidate volumes across styles, and communicate forecasts to suppliers.
    • Negotiate MOQ and pricing with mills, balancing cost, flexibility, and supplier capabilities.
    • Maintain strong relationships with fabric mills and vendors to ensure delivery timelines and quality expectations are met.
    • Proactively resolve any technical or commercial fabric issues that arise during development or production.
